Background Information:

The G protein-coupled receptors ETA and ETB are both endothelin receptors whose activation results in the elevation of intracellular-free calcium. ETA is expressed primarily on vascular smooth muscles, mediating vasoconstriction and sodium retention, leading to increased blood pressure. ETB is expressed predominantly on the endothelial surface of vessels, mediating vasodilatation through the production of nitric oxide and prostacyclin. ETA activation has damaging effects on preeclampsia, heart failure, pulmonary hypertension, and kidney natriuresis. Endothelin-receptor antagonists (ERA) can improve exercise capacity, hemodynamics, symptoms, and right ventricle function as an important treatment of hypertension. The selective blockade of ETA blocks only the harmful vasoconstriction effects of ETA but maintains the potential beneficial effects mediated by ETB (vasodilatation and endothelin clearance).

Testing Information

Procedure Summary:

Human recombinant endothelin ETA receptors expressed in Chem-1 cells are used. Test compound and/or vehicle is incubated with the cells (1.5 x 10^6 /ml) in stimulation buffer of IP1 Tb kit for 30 minutes at 37°C. Test compound-induced increase of fluorescence by 50 percent or more (≥50%) relative to the 1 μM endothelin-1 response indicates possible ETA receptor agonist activity. Test compound-induced inhibition of 1 nM endothelin-1 induced increase of fluorescence response by 50 percent or more (≥50%) indicates receptor antagonist activity.

Clinical Relevance

Therapeutic Area:

Cardiovascular

Adverse / Beneficial Action:

ETA receptor agonism may cause vasoconstriction, positive inotropy, and facilitate cell proliferation (e.g., smooth muscle, mesangial cells).
